The Lebanon national football team, governed by the Lebanese Football Association, has been competing under FIFA since 1935. Based in Beirut, Lebanon competes in the AFC's qualifying rounds for the FIFA World Cup and the AFC Asian Cup. The team achieved a landmark result by qualifying for the AFC Asian Cup 2000, their most notable tournament appearance. Lebanon has faced considerable challenges due to regional instability but has continued developing football through domestic leagues and international friendlies. Notable players include Abbas Chahrour and Roda Antar, who raised Lebanon's profile in European football. The squad draws from domestic clubs and the Lebanese diaspora worldwide. In recent years the national team has shown improvement under various coaching stints, targeting a return to the AFC Asian Cup finals.
